Household Responses to Drought in Fentale Pastoral Woreda of Oromia Regional State, Ethiopia
@inproceedings{Bekele2012HouseholdRT, title={Household Responses to Drought in Fentale Pastoral Woreda of Oromia Regional State, Ethiopia}, author={Abera Bekele and A. Amsalu}, year={2012} }
Fentale pastoralists have been undertaking a set of responses to mitigate the adverse effects of the present day severe recurrent drought on the livelihood sources of the households. This study was conducted to investigate responses that are undertaken to drought by households in Fentale pastoral Woreda of Oromia Regional State in Ethiopia.
